Changes

From SME Server
Jump to navigationJump to search
77 bytes added ,  20:36, 26 August 2023
nczea
Line 284: Line 284:  
En général vous ne trouverez ce message que dans les fichiers journaux car, par défaut (cf. supra), PHP est configuré pour empêcher l'affichage de messages d'erreur aux utilisateurs finaux. Cela peut être modifié selon [[PHP#Display_Error_Messages|ce guide en anglais]].
 
En général vous ne trouverez ce message que dans les fichiers journaux car, par défaut (cf. supra), PHP est configuré pour empêcher l'affichage de messages d'erreur aux utilisateurs finaux. Cela peut être modifié selon [[PHP#Display_Error_Messages|ce guide en anglais]].
   −
====Modifying the PHPBaseDir setting for an ibay====
+
====Modification du paramètre PHPBaseDir pour une baie d'information====
 
<ol>
 
<ol>
(Please also see: [http://wiki.contribs.org/Useful_Commands#PHP_Related_Commands these] instructions on the [http://wiki.contribs.org/Useful_Commands Useful_Commands] page.)
+
(Veuillez aussi prendre connaissance de [http://wiki.contribs.org/Useful_Commands#PHP_Related_Commands ces instructions] en anglais sur la page [http://wiki.contribs.org/Useful_Commands "commandes utiles".])
<!--Please do not remove the following closing tag as a fromatting/rendering bug will kick in, for more details see: http://bugzilla.wikimedia.org/show_bug.cgi?id=10893--><li>Open a SME Server shell as root user and document the current setting of the PHPBaseDir directive by writing down the output of the following command:
+
<li>Ouvrez un shell du serveur SME en tant qu'utilisateur root et documentez le paramètre actuel de la directive PHPBaseDir en notant le résultat de la commande suivante :
 +
 
 +
 
 
  db accounts getprop ibayname PHPBaseDir  
 
  db accounts getprop ibayname PHPBaseDir  
Be careful to write it down to the letter as we need it in the next step
+
Attention à l'écrire à la lettre car nous en aurons besoin à l'étape suivante.
For the Primary ibay the ouptut of above command would normally look like this:
+
Pour la baie d'information principale, le résultat de la commande ci-dessus ressemblerait normalement à ceci :
 
  /home/e-smith/files/ibays/Primary/html/
 
  /home/e-smith/files/ibays/Primary/html/
</li><li>Decide on what directory you would like to add and issue the following:
+
</li><li>Décidez du répertoire que vous souhaitez ajouter et lancez ce qui suit :
 
  db accounts setprop ibayname PHPBaseDir value
 
  db accounts setprop ibayname PHPBaseDir value
Replace ibayname with the name of the ibay and value with the old value for the PHPBaseDir directive you have written down and a colon (:) followed by the full path to the directory you would like to add with a tailing slash (/), e.g.
+
Remplacer "ibayname" par le nom de la baie et "value" par l'ancienne valeur de la directive PHPBaseDir que vous avez écrite et deux points (:) suivis du chemin complet vers le répertoire que vous souhaitez ajouter avec une barre oblique (/), par exemple :
 
  db accounts setprop Primary PHPBaseDir /home/e-smith/files/ibays/Primary/html/:/opt/gallery2/
 
  db accounts setprop Primary PHPBaseDir /home/e-smith/files/ibays/Primary/html/:/opt/gallery2/
Above command would allow for invocation of scripts in the /opt/gallery2 path from the Primary ibay html folder by PHP.
+
 
To allow uploading of files to via http to a ibay name wiki
+
La commande ci-dessus permettrait à PHP d'invoquer des scripts dans le chemin /opt/gallery2 à partir du dossier HTML de la baie principale.
 +
Pour permettre le téléchargement de fichiers via http vers un wiki dénommé "ibay" :
 
  db accounts setprop wiki PHPBaseDir /home/e-smith/files/ibays/wiki/:/tmp/
 
  db accounts setprop wiki PHPBaseDir /home/e-smith/files/ibays/wiki/:/tmp/
   −
</li><li>After defining the new setting we need to reflect the change in the configuration file of the web server and have the web server reload it's configuration file. This is done by issuing the following command:
+
</li><li>Après avoir défini le nouveau paramètre, nous devons refléter la modification dans le fichier de configuration du serveur Web et demander au serveur Web de recharger son fichier de configuration. Cela se fait en exécutant la commande suivante :
 
  signal-event ibay-modify ibayname
 
  signal-event ibay-modify ibayname
   −
Be sure to replace ibayname with the name of the ibay you have just modified.
+
Assurez-vous de remplacer "ibayname" par le nom de la baie que vous venez de modifier.
 
</li></ol>
 
</li></ol>
 
===Upload_tmp_dir===
 
===Upload_tmp_dir===
3,072

edits

Navigation menu